The Enduring Legacy of Michelangelo's David

Michelangelo's monument stands as a testament of Renaissance artistic brilliance. Sculpted from a single block of marble, the work captures the essence of youthful power and intellectual prowess. Commissioned by the city of Florence in the late 15th century, David was meant for a powerful political statement, celebrating the republic's resistance against tyranny.

Beyond its political meaning, David has become an enduring emblem of human potential and achievement. The sculpture's anatomical precision is breathtaking, revealing Michelangelo's extensive understanding of the human form. Over centuries, David has captivated artists, intellectuals, and admirers from around the world, solidifying its place as a cornerstone of Western art history.

Exploring the Genius Behind Michelangelo's David

David's monumental sculpture stands as a embodiment of the human form’s potential. Created in the early 16th century, the statue has enchanted audiences for centuries with its striking proportions.

Sculpting David was no small feat. Michelangelo committed years to honing every detail, from the veins that ripple beneath his surface to the determined stare of his face. The level of detail is evident in every curve, making David more than just a figure of art.

It’s not just the physical aspects that make Michelangelo's creation so powerful. The statue also symbolizes the ideal of Renaissance thought. David, the young shepherd who triumphed the giant Goliath, became a icon of human perseverance over challenges.
